Anticipatory Bail - Petitioner seeks anticipatory bail in FIR involving charges under IPC Sections 420, 467, 468, 471, 120-B, and Section 13(1)(d), 13(2) of Prevention of Corruption Act, 1988 - Petitioner a first-time offender - Nature of allegations and the need to provide an opportunity to course correct justifies consideration for bail.
